What is a Plant Operator?

Before we go any further, let’s clarify the role of a plant operator. A plant operator is a trained professional responsible for handling, maintaining, and operating heavy machinery and equipment used in a variety of industries like construction, agriculture, and infrastructure. From excavators and bulldozers to cranes and loaders, plant operators play a crucial role in ensuring projects run smoothly and efficiently.

Plant operators are integral to the success of construction, demolition, and infrastructure development, making them highly sought-after professionals in the modern workforce. They ensure safety, follow strict compliance protocols, monitor equipment performance, and ensure that machinery is used effectively to meet project deadlines.

Key Responsibilities

Here’s what you can expect if you join Team RAL as a plant operator:

  • Operating Machinery: Use heavy equipment such as diggers, bulldozers, loaders, and graders.
  • Equipment Maintenance: Inspect and maintain machinery to ensure it remains in good working condition.
  • Safety Protocols: Follow strict health and safety measures to minimize risks on-site.
  • Precision Work: Execute precise machine operation tasks to meet project objectives.
  • Collaboration: Work with a team of project managers, engineers, and other skilled professionals to complete projects effectively.

Skills and Qualifications Needed

To thrive as a plant operator with Team RAL, you’ll need the following:

  • Experience working with heavy machinery (certifications such as CPCS or NPORS are typically looked upon favorably).
  • A strong understanding of safety regulations.
  • Physical stamina and attention to detail.
  • A good work ethic and reliability.
  • The ability to adapt to fast-paced environments.
